Applications of Industrial Aluminum Turning Parts

2024-06-20

Industrial aluminum turning parts refer to components made from aluminum that have been manufactured through the process of turning. Turning is a machining process where a cutting tool is used to remove material from a rotating workpiece to create cylindrical parts with precise dimensions. These parts are widely used in various industrial sectors due to aluminum's favorable properties, such as light weight, corrosion resistance, and machinability. Here’s an overview of industrial aluminum turning parts, their applications, benefits, and considerations:

Applications of Industrial Aluminum Turning Parts:

1. Automotive Industry:

  - Components: Engine parts, transmission components, brackets, and fittings.

  - Benefits: Aluminum's lightweight nature helps improve fuel efficiency and performance.

2. Aerospace Industry:

  - Components: Aircraft structural components, landing gear parts, and interior fittings.

  - Benefits: Aluminum's strength-to-weight ratio is crucial for aerospace applications, reducing overall weight without compromising structural integrity.

3. Electronics and Electrical Industry:

  - Components: Heat sinks, connectors, housings, and enclosures for electronic devices.

  - Benefits: Aluminum's thermal conductivity and electrical conductivity properties are advantageous for heat dissipation and electrical applications.

4. Construction and Architectural Industry:

  - Components: Window frames, door frames, structural supports, and decorative elements.

  - Benefits: Aluminum's corrosion resistance and aesthetic appeal make it a preferred choice for architectural applications.

5. Industrial Equipment and Machinery:

  - Components: Shafts, couplings, valves, and various mechanical parts.

  - Benefits: Aluminum's machinability and durability contribute to the efficiency and reliability of industrial machinery.


Benefits of Industrial Aluminum Turning Parts:

1. Lightweight: Aluminum is significantly lighter than steel, making it ideal for applications where weight reduction is critical without sacrificing strength.

2. Corrosion Resistance: Aluminum naturally forms a protective oxide layer, enhancing its resistance to corrosion in various environments.

3. Machinability: Aluminum is relatively easy to machine, allowing for efficient production of complex shapes and precise dimensions.

4. Thermal and Electrical Conductivity: Aluminum has good thermal conductivity, making it suitable for heat sinks and other thermal management applications. It also conducts electricity effectively.

5. Aesthetic Appeal: Aluminum can be anodized or coated for enhanced appearance and durability, making it versatile for both functional and decorative applications.


Considerations for Manufacturing and Usage:

1. Material Selection: Choose the appropriate aluminum alloy based on mechanical properties required (e.g., strength, hardness, toughness) and environmental factors (e.g., temperature, corrosion resistance).

2. Design Considerations: Optimize designs for manufacturability to minimize material waste and machining time, considering factors such as tool paths and fixturing.

3. Surface Finish: Consider surface finish requirements (e.g., smoothness, texture) and post-processing treatments (e.g., anodizing, powder coating) for enhanced functionality and appearance.

4. Tolerances and Precision: Ensure parts meet specified tolerances and dimensional accuracy required for their intended function and assembly.

5. Quality Control: Implement rigorous quality control measures throughout the manufacturing process to ensure consistency and reliability of aluminum turning parts.
